MILK the 1960s with Eddie and the Gold Tops at Tenbury Wells this March.

But the scene will be set at Green Hammerton in Yorkshire, back in the Swinging 60s, in a bid to transport an audience back to the days of the fashion, music and teenage optimism which defined a generation.

The hero is Eddie the local milkman, a conscientious chap who becomes a beat group star quite by accident.

Eddie has inherited the family milk round from his father and he has fulfilled his deathbed promise to never miss a delivery for the good people of the village. But suddenly things are on the up.

A spokesman said: "His songs are heading up the charts and if he can get there by tonight he’ll be on Top of The Pops.

"But when things take a churn for the worse, how on earth will he get back for the morning milk round?"

The show comes to St Michael’s Village Hall, Tenbury Wells, on March 30 at 7.30pm.
